About the Role:

The Procurement Manager owns supplier relationships, cost structure, and commercial performance across Bushbalm’s global supply base. This newly created role ensures we are buying the right materials and finished goods at the right cost, with the right terms, from the right partners.

Working closely with Inventory Planning and Product Development, the Procurement Manager negotiates pricing, manages MOQs and lead times, expands and diversifies the supplier base, and protects margin as we scale.

This is a commercially focused, supplier-facing role that sits between Product Development, Inventory Planning, and Operations.

The salary range for this role is $100,000 - $110,000 CAD.

Key Responsibilities:

Supplier Management & Commercial Ownership

  • Own relationships with all finished goods suppliers, component vendors, and co-manufacturers.

  • Negotiate pricing, MOQs, payment terms, and capacity commitments.

  • Manage supplier performance, accountability, and continuous improvement.

  • Identify and mitigate single-source and supply risk.

  • Drive annual cost-down initiatives and margin improvement plans.

Strategic Sourcing & Supplier Expansion

  • Partner with Product Development during new product launches to vet and onboard suppliers.

  • Evaluate suppliers not only for capacity and capability, but also for cost competitiveness, scalability, and operational reliability.

  • Develop dual-sourcing strategies where appropriate.

  • Continuously benchmark supplier pricing and capabilities.

Cost Control & Margin Protection

  • Monitor raw material and component cost fluctuations.

  • Flag cost increases early and lead mitigation plans.

  • Partner with Finance on COGS targets and budget alignment.

  • Structure pricing agreements that protect long-term margin.

Partnership with Inventory Planning

  • Align with Inventory Planner on order timing, forecasted volumes, and supply constraints.

  • Balance MOQ constraints with inventory health and cash flow objectives.

  • Ensure supplier commitments match the rolling inventory plan.

  • Support escalation management on supply or capacity risks.

Process, Systems & Governance

  • Maintain accurate supplier master data (pricing, lead times, MOQs, contracts).

  • Build structured negotiation documentation and contract tracking.

  • Support ERP integrity related to supplier pricing and purchasing.

  • Create reporting around cost performance, supplier KPIs, and savings initiatives.
